What is a galaxy lithium ion battery cabinet?
The Galaxy Lithium-ion Battery Cabinets for 3-phase UPSs are sustainable, innovative energy storage solutions for data centers, industrial processes, and critical infrastructures. This UL9540A-compliant battery solution reduces battery footprint and weight by up to 70%, allowing more effective use of space.
How many battery cabinets can a Lib 25 m cable supply?
LIBSEOPT001 Galaxy LIB 25 m communication cable kit 1 990-91430E-001 17 Overview of Accessory Kits With 10, 13, 16, or 17 Battery Modules 1. One AC/DC converter box can supply up to 10 battery cabinets. For 11+ battery cabinets, at least two AC/DC converter boxes are required. 2. Install one data log kit for each battery system.
What is Galaxy lithium-ion battery Data Kit?
Data kit option to record Galaxy Lithium-ion Battery operation history and event logs throughout the life span, which can be used for technical analysis and warranty. Embedded monitoring at the cell, module, and cabinet level provides a clear picture of battery health.
